Definition of Cosmetology<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"SubiacoCosmetology is a profession that is all about making the human body look more attractive through the application of cosmetics. So naturally it makes sense that numerous cosmetology schools are described as beauty schools. Most of us think of makeup when we hear the term cosmetics, but basically a cosmetic can be almost anything that improves the look of a person’s skin, hair or nails. In order to work as a cosmetologist, most states require that you undergo some form of specialized training and then become licensed. Once you are licensed, the work environments include not only Subiaco AR beauty salons and barber shops, but also such businesses as spas, hotels and resorts. Many cosmetologists, once they have acquired experience and a customer base, open their own shops or salons. Others will start servicing customers either in their own homes or will travel to the client’s residence, or both.
